Sometimes the last digits of numbers can help you decide whether calculator computations are correct. Given that one of 19,\( 379 ; 19,387 \); and 19,383 is the correct result of multiplying 213 by 91 , which answer is correct? Tell how a consideration of last digits helped you answer part (a). Choose the correct answer below. Use the Show Work feature to provide related calculations and additional reasoning to support your answer. A. 19,379 B. 19,387 C. 19,383

To determine which of the numbers \(19,379\), \(19,387\), or \(19,383\) is the correct result of multiplying \(213\) by \(91\), we can first calculate the product and then analyze the last digits of the potential answers. ### Step 1: Calculate the product of \(213\) and \(91\) Let's perform the multiplication: \[ P = 213 \times 91 \] ### Step 2: Analyze the last digits Next, we will find the last digit of \(P\) and compare it with the last digits of the given options. 1. **Last digit of \(213\)**: The last digit is \(3\). 2. **Last digit of \(91\)**: The last digit is \(1\). Now, we can find the last digit of the product \(P\) by multiplying the last digits of \(213\) and \(91\): \[ \text{Last digit of } P = 3 \times 1 = 3 \] ### Step 3: Check the last digits of the options Now, let's check the last digits of the options: - **Last digit of \(19,379\)**: \(9\) - **Last digit of \(19,387\)**: \(7\) - **Last digit of \(19,383\)**: \(3\) ### Conclusion Since the last digit of the product \(P\) is \(3\), the only option that matches this last digit is \(19,383\). Thus, the correct answer is: **C. 19,383** ### Reasoning The consideration of last digits helped us quickly eliminate \(19,379\) and \(19,387\) as possible correct answers because their last digits do not match the last digit of the product \(P\). This method is a useful check for verifying calculations without performing the full multiplication.
